CPD Opportunities Provided by SII
The use of CPD oppportunities offered by the SII is, wherever possible, automatically logged by the Institute on behalf of its members to help save them time. On this page, we have listed all the different CPD offerings we provide, along with an indication of which of the four learning types they fall into and whether or not their use is logged automatically.

Active Learning
Attending an SII Training Course, Conference or CPD Event
The Securities & Investment Institute runs a programme of free-to-members lectures in both London and the regions. All SII conferences, workshops and CPD events are allocated a number of claimable hours dependent on the type of event. The appropriate hours are automatically allocated to the member's CPD logs within 48 hours of the event taking place.
Attending an SII Professional Interest Forum(PIF)
Professional Interest Forums (PIFs) are discussion groups open to members of the Securities & Investment Institute. Meeting on a regular basis, they enable members to meet and discuss topical issues with others working in their area of the financial services industry. Members are automatically allocated 1.5 hours to their CPD logs for attendance and participation at PIF events.
Sitting SII Examinations
All SII exam candidates are automatically allocated CPD hours equivalent to the duration of the examination, upon delivery of their results. However, a examination pass entitles a candidate to receive quadruple the original examination hours in recognition of the preparation needed to pass an SII examination.
Members accessing SII Professional Refresher or any other relevant elearning tools are entitled to claim the appropriate hours of usage as part of the Active learning CPD category.
Reflective Learning
SII Infolink
SII Infolink is an online library developed by the Securities & Investment Institute only for its members. Use of Infolink earns members Reflective CPD hours equivalent to the hours of use.
eCPD - SII Webcasts
Available exclusively to members, eCPD allows members to view webcasts, podcasts and slides from major SII events and CPD lectures. With presentations grouped by professional interest, members can navigate to their specific area of interest with ease. Use of eCPD earns members Reflective CPD hours equivalent to the hours of viewing a webcast or listening to a podcast.
Self-Directed Learning
Reading S&I Review Securities & Investment Review is the official members' magazine of the SII. It is a free benefit, issued 10 times a year. Reading the S&I Review may be logged as Self-Directed learning.
Securities & Investment Review is also available as an online publication. Reading the S&I Review Online is recorded automatically as Self-Directed learning.
Reading Regulatory Update
Composed by SII Senior Advisor, Christopher Bond MSI, the Regulatory Update is an indispensable, quarterly guide to changes and hot topics in the world of financial regulation. Reading the Regulatory Update each quarter earns members the appropriate number of hours spent on the activity under the 'Self-directed' learning element.
Development of Others
Presenting at SII seminars, PIFs, conferences or training courses
Those who present at SII events earn CPD hours under the Development of Others category, and these are logged automatically. Presenting earns members hours equivalent to triple the event length.
Chairing at SII seminars, PIFs, conferences or training courses
Those who chair SII events earn CPD hours under the Development of Others category, and these are logged automatically. Chairing earns members hours equivalent to double the event length (half of these hours fall under the Active category and half under Development of Others).
Being a member of an SII Committee or Exam Subject Panel
Those who sit on Institute Panels or Committees (eg, PIF Committees, or Exam Syllabus Panels) earn CPD hours under the Development of Others category, and these are logged automatically. The hours are equivalent to the event length.
